In the wake of a record-breaking Survivor Series: WarGames 2025 event at Petco Park in San Diego, the WWE is already looking ahead to its 2026 slate of shows. Sources close to the organization indicate that the company is eager to capitalize on the massive success of its latest stadium event and is actively exploring opportunities to host another stadium show for next year’s Survivor Series.
According to a WWE insider, the company is considering multiple locations for the 2026 event, with a focus on sites that can accommodate a large capacity crowd and offer a unique backdrop for the show. Petco Park, which hosted this year’s event, provided an ideal combination of size, amenities, and scenic views that helped make the show a huge success.
“We’re always looking for ways to innovate and give our fans an unforgettable experience,” said the insider. “The success of Survivor Series: WarGames 2025 has opened up a lot of possibilities for us, and we’re excited to explore new venues and opportunities for the 2026 event.”
While no official announcements have been made, WWE officials are reportedly considering a number of potential locations for the 2026 show, including major sports stadiums and iconic landmarks. The goal is to create an event that will not only break attendance and revenue records but also provide a memorable experience for fans.
Survivor Series: WarGames 2025 was a huge success, with a sold-out crowd of over 43,000 fans packing Petco Park to see a stacked card featuring top WWE talent. The event shattered records for both attendance and gate revenue, cementing its place as one of the most successful Survivor Series events in company history.
